Carlos Correa Optimistic for 2024 After Swing Overhaul
The Twins shortstop has made significant adjustments to his swing mechanics, aiming to rebound from last season's challenges.
- Carlos Correa arrives at Twins spring training with a revamped swing, aiming for a bounce-back season.
- After a challenging year, Correa's offseason adjustments focus on a more compact, efficient swing to overcome previous struggles.
- The Twins star shortstop enjoyed a 'chill' offseason, focusing on family and baseball without the distractions of free agency.
- Correa's new swing mechanics, including lower hands and a toe tap, are designed to improve his offensive performance.
- The Twins have high hopes for Correa, believing a healthy season could significantly boost their offensive output.
